Energenius® OST Program Family Engagement Event Overview

Energenius® Out of School Time Program training modules were created through a partnership between PG&E and CalSAC. The program is designed to engage children and youth to think about how they use energy, how energy is measured and paid for, and ways to save energy. Children and youth will understand how they can help reduce the impacts of energy use and production on the environment, and also practice influencing others to take energy-saving actions. These new modules are uniquely and intentionally designed to engage families in what youth are learning as well as provide families with resources for CARE, a PG&E program that incentivizes families to put energy saving practices to use and save on their energy bill, ESA, as well as Rate Awareness and Education.

CalSAC is excited to offer funding for programs in PG&E service areas to host a family engagement event through the Energenius® OST Program. Strengthen the quality of your program and deepen your program’s impact on energy conservation through hosting a family engagement event. 

Below are the requirements for the funding level:

$500 funding level requirements:
- Requesting the two training modules from Energenius OST Training Series by December 2018
- Host family engagement event for minimum of 10 families by December 2018. Families includes adults and any siblings.
- Share the PG&E resources with families during the event
- Share provided flyers with families and event participants when outreaching for the event
- Utilize 8 hour of Technical Assistance from a CalSAC Trainer
- Complete and submit sign in sheets of adult participants within two weeks after the event
- Complete and submit feedback form within two weeks after the event

*Limit of one event per site, 2 sites per agency*
